Comprehensive Guide to Vaccination Consent
What is the Vaccination Consent Form?
The Vaccination Consent Form is a critical document utilized by South Forsyth Family Medicine and Pediatrics to secure parental consent for pediatric vaccinations. This form ensures compliance with the guidelines established by the CDC and AAP, helping guardians make informed choices about their child's health.
This form integrates a thorough outline of available vaccines, requiring the guardian's signature for authorization, and includes a patient eligibility section for the 'Vaccines For Children' program.
Purpose and Benefits of the Vaccination Consent Form
Obtaining parental consent through the Vaccination Consent Form is crucial for ensuring children receive their vaccinations safely and effectively. This form empowers parents and guardians, providing them with the necessary information to make educated decisions regarding their child's vaccinations.
Furthermore, the form plays a key role in screening vaccine eligibility and facilitating access to programs designed for children's vaccination needs, such as the 'Vaccines For Children' initiative.

Who needs to sign the Vaccination Consent Form?
The Vaccination Consent Form must be signed by a parent or legal guardian of the child requiring the vaccinations. This ensures that consent is formally documented for the child's immunization.
What information is required to complete the form?
You will need your child's full name, date of birth, and the guardian's name and signature. Additionally, ensure to review the vaccines available and check eligibility for the 'Vaccines For Children' program.
Is notarization required for this form?
No, notarization is not required for the Vaccination Consent Form. The guardian's signature is sufficient to provide consent for the vaccinations.

What is the purpose of the eligibility screening section?
The eligibility screening section helps determine if your child qualifies for the 'Vaccines For Children' program, ensuring they receive vaccinations based on federal guidelines.
